NAME
usetc - Low level helper function for writing Unicode text data. Allegro game programming library. SYNOPSIS
#include <allegro.h> int usetc(char *s, int c); DESCRIPTION
Low level helper function for writing Unicode text data. Writes the character `c' to the address pointed to by `s'. RETURN VALUE
Returns the number of bytes written, which is equal to the width of the character in the current encoding format. SEE ALSO
